Use Social Media Strategically

Focus on Platforms That Actually Convert

Instagram, TikTok, and X (Twitter) are the usual suspects, but not all are equal. Instagram is where fans discover you. Twitter is where you can post a bit more freely. TikTok, while tricky with bans, can explode your traffic when used smartly. You do not need to be everywhere. You need to be good where it counts.

Use each platform differently. Post teasers on Instagram to build mystery. Drop call-to-actions on Twitter for direct click-throughs. Use TikTok to tease personality, not just body. These channels are the lifeblood of your funnel. Do not treat them as afterthoughts. Each one plays a different role in the fan journey. TikTok grabs attention, Instagram builds trust, and Twitter closes. Stick to one main channel to start, master it, and expand only when you have the time and energy to do it well.

Avoid Shadow Bans (Or Escape Them)

Post the wrong stuff and Instagram may shadow ban you. That means less visibility, fewer clicks, and slower growth. Use non-explicit language, avoid flagged hashtags, and always keep a backup account. But that is just step one. The algorithm can be unpredictable, so adapt fast. Use safe language like “spicy site” or “exclusive content” instead of platform names. If your engagement drops overnight, remove recent hashtags, post a story asking followers if they see your posts, and take a short break to reset your activity. Want to dig deeper? Nail Your Profile Setup

Your Bio Is Your Hook

If your bio sounds like a grocery list, you are missing sales. Write it like a flirty elevator pitch. Speak to what fans want. Add personality. A little cheeky, a little classy. A good bio should tease your best traits and make the click irresistible. Keep it short and fun, but clear about what they are getting. Emojis help catch attention. Lines like “your virtual girlfriend” or “exclusive & uncensored” can boost curiosity. Add FOMO. Let them know what they will miss if they scroll past. Need inspiration? Make the Link Count

Use a Linktree or Beacons if needed, but don’t clutter it. One link should point directly to your OnlyFans or landing page. Keep it clean. Keep it obvious. Put your best content front and center. If you’re linking to multiple platforms, prioritize the one that pays you. Avoid long descriptions and use custom link buttons with strong calls to action like “Join my spicy club” or “Peek behind the curtain.” And yes, test your links regularly. Broken links kill conversions. Mobile view matters most, so make sure it looks good on a phone.

Set a Scroll-Stopping Banner

A low-effort banner signals low-effort content. Invest in a clean, well-designed banner that shows off your vibe. This is one of the first things people notice, so treat it like your storefront. Match your color palette, include your name or handle, and showcase your personality. Avoid clutter or small text. A good banner should tell people in one glance what they can expect inside your page. Add subtle hints of exclusivity or mystery. Turn Messages Into Money

Use Structured Chat Scripts

Messaging is where the money is. Fans do not always subscribe for content. They subscribe for *you*. Flirting, teasing, connection — that is what keeps them paying. Do not wing it. Use proven chat frameworks. Have a structure. Open with a hook, create emotional tension, and offer a PPV that matches the mood. Want real-world templates? Automate Without Losing Personality

Autoresponders save time. But if they read like bots, fans will ghost you. Blend automation with personal touches. Pre-write multiple openers and rotate them. Use variables for names or preferences. Invest in Visual Quality

Lighting and Angles Make or Break Content

Your phone is good enough. But your lighting might not be. Softbox lights, ring lights, and natural daylight can take your content from basic to binge-worthy. Avoid grainy footage. Brand Yourself Visually

Pick 2-3 brand colors and stick with them. Use consistent fonts in stories, captions, and banners. Wear similar tones. This creates visual identity. Fans start recognizing your content instantly, even off-platform. This kind of branding increases clicks and trust — and that boosts earnings.

Plan Paid Promotions Carefully

Start With Small Ad Campaigns

Use Reddit ads or third-party shoutout pages before jumping into big Meta or Google Ads campaigns. Test what thumbnails work. Track click-through and conversion. Paid ads can work, but they burn cash fast if you’re not careful. Always measure ROI. Do not run ads without a solid funnel in place. Warm traffic works better. Cold leads take more effort and content volume to convert.

Collaborate With Other Creators

Collabs = reach x2. Share each other’s content. Do story swaps. Feature each other in PPVs. This gives both your audiences something new to get excited about. But pick collab partners wisely. Vibes must match. Avoid creators with bad reputations. And always use a collab release form to stay safe and legal.

Track, Improve, Repeat

Know Your Numbers

What sells? What flops? Dive into your analytics. Look at content views, PPV open rates, tip trends. Patterns tell you what fans love. Do more of that. Less of what bores them. If you don’t know your numbers, you are guessing. And guessing is not a strategy.

Build a Feedback Loop

Ask fans what they want. Use polls. Send flirty questions in chat. Build anticipation. Then deliver. This turns passive subs into obsessed fans. Use your DMs to test new ideas before publishing them publicly. This mini feedback loop increases loyalty and reduces churn.
